Don't want to replace Beamer, but I would like someone to put pressure on him. I don't know with the staff that we have that we can get any further than a 10 win season with an ACC Championship and usually losing to a better team in the bowl, which is certainly nothing to complain about. Living in the DC area, the UMD program always reminds me of how bad it COULD be.
No one in Blacksburg has the cojones to fire Beamer, and I'm not sure they even have enough to put real pressure on him to do more. Also, from what I've read repeatedly the big money donors are relatively satisfied with the success of the program and aren't really pushing for more (not that one can really blame them, considering that the big money donors likely remember the pre-Beamer era and are happy with where the program is) I do respect Beamer for shaking up the staff by adding Brown and Shane Beamer. I really hope Shane can bring in better recruits and Brown should be a good addition to the defensive staff.
Its hard to be too critical of Stiney/O'Cain looking at the numbers from this year but I still don't like our overall OL play against the better opponents and I still find myself pulling my hair out at some of the offensive play calling. However, I don't know that we have the offensive minds on this staff to really take us to (and win) a National Title. MV1 isn't coming back and I don't really believe Logan Thomas will be able to carry the team the way Vick did and put us in the MNC game.
On defense, the lack of pressure on Beamer trickles down to a lack of pressure on Foster and while Bud is certainly a fantastic coach his scheme and tendency to go with smaller players (especially in the front 7) can be frustrating at times when they get worked by a bigger OL. Obviously that wasn't the case in the Sugar Bowl and I have to give credit to Foster and his staff, the defense played the game of their lives. However, Foster should not be immune to criticism--it seems to me that he gets a free pass by a huge portion of the fanbase because of his success, which is fair in part but when the defense DOES struggle in a big game he should shoulder the blame.
So what do we do? Do we give O'Cain time (though his resume at Clemson wasn't overly impressive) and hope that the addition of Shane will bring in recruits? I think that is exactly what Beamer will do and unless the team really starts struggling over a few years I doubt anyone who has the money or power to do anything about it will complain. Again, I think the younger fans (myself included) have only really seen the successful VT teams and want more, whereas the real movers and shakers are older and remember the tough times VT went through before we were routinely winning 10 games and going to ACC Championships and BCS games and are somewhat satisfied with the program. I would love to see a young, new offensive mind brought in that can match the success that Foster has had on the other side of the ball but I don't see Beamer doing that while he's at the helm.Last edited by HammerTime; Wed Jan 11 2012 at 12:47 PM.
